Hush Hush by Becca Fitzpatrick
When I first heard about Hush, Hush by Becca Fitzpatrick, I was both intrigued and wary. The reason I was wary was because Hush, Hush is very comparable to Stephenie Meyer’s Twilight series. Now if an author can ride on Meyer’s coattails and have an original idea and really make it shine, I’m all for that. But in the case of Hush, Hush I’m afraid to say that Fitzpatrick has not only ridden on Meyer’s coattails, but hopped on her back and took every single thing from Twilight and placed it in Hush, Hush. The comparisons between Twilight and Hush, Hush are too strong not to ignore and honestly, Hush, Hush reads like a Twilight fan fiction where Fitzpatrick decided to change the characters and a bit of the plot that fails in so many ways. If you’re going to take someone else’s idea and try to build on it, at least be smart about it. Hush, Hush should have a lot to recommend about it. I will begin to say that Fitzpatrick’s writing is commendable, but the way she has set things are so disjointed and stilted. I did like Nora in the beginning but then she ventured into the too stupid to live zone. The way she and Vee acted in regards to Patch was too immature and eye rolling. Why would you be so interested in Patch who comes across as a verbally abusive individual who makes you frightened for your life? Nora is never really attracted to Patch because the majority of the time she lives in fear of him. At one point she is in the library underground parking garage and plays catch me if you can around a car with Patch because she doesn’t want him to come near her. At no point do we see Nora giving any real reason why she would be so interested in Patch. There is nothing redeemable about him in the least. Want to hear a big cliché? Nora is on a bus and gets off a stop where the bus driver says it’s not safe. Nora shrugs it off and actually walks down a dark, dank alley! Good grief. As for Patch, he is a manipulative jerk. I can’t help but bring up the comparison with him and Edward. |
